IEM is looking for a detail-oriented and proactive Materials Planning Specialist to join our manufacturing team in Surrey, B.C. In this mid-level role, you will be responsible for coordinating production scheduling, managing inventory levels, and ensuring materials and finished goods flow efficiently through our facility. You will serve as a key link between production, purchasing, logistics, and customer service teams.

Please note: This position requires 100% in-office presence in our Surrey, B.C. offices and does not offer remote work.

Key Responsibilities

Collaborate closely with the Production Scheduler to support schedule adherence, flag inventory-driven constraints, and communicate material availability impacts on production timelines

Monitor raw material, WIP (work-in-progress), and finished goods inventory levels to ensure adequate supply without excess

Conduct regular cycle counts and physical inventory audits; investigate and resolve discrepancies

Coordinate with procurement to ensure timely purchasing of materials based on production requirements and lead times

Analyze inventory data and production metrics to identify trends, inefficiencies, and opportunities for improvement

Maintain accurate records in the ERP/MRP system (e.g., SAP, Oracle, NetSuite, Infor) including BOMs, routings, and inventory transactions

Communicate production status, delays, and capacity constraints to relevant stakeholders

Work closely with the warehouse team to ensure proper storage, labeling, and organization of inventory

Support new product launches by coordinating material readiness and production ramp-up plans

Assist in developing and enforcing inventory control policies and procedures

Generate and distribute production and inventory reports to management on a regular basis

Qualifications

Bachelor’s Degree in Industrial Engineering, Supply Chain, Operations Management, or equivalent experience.

3–5 years of experience in production planning, inventory control, or a related role within a manufacturing environment

Proficiency with ERP/MRP systems (e.g., SAP, Oracle, NetSuite, Infor, or similar)

Strong understanding of manufacturing processes, BOMs, and supply chain principles

Experience with Lean manufacturing or continuous improvement methodologies

Solid analytical and problem-solving skills with high attention to detail

Proficiency in Microsoft Excel (pivot tables, VLOOKUP, data analysis)

Excellent organizational and time management skills

Strong communication and interpersonal skills with the ability to work cross-functionally

Preferred:

APICS CPIM or CSCP designation (or in progress)

Familiarity with demand forecasting and capacity planning

[Compensation Range:  $33.00 - 43.00/hr CAD]
